What is Wi-Fi, and How Does it Work?

Before we dive into the reasons why you might have Wi-Fi but no internet, it’s essential to understand what Wi-Fi is and how it works. Wi-Fi is a type of wireless networking technology that allows devices to connect to the internet or communicate with each other without the use of physical cables. It operates on a specific frequency band, typically 2.4 GHz or 5 GHz, and uses radio waves to transmit data between devices. When you connect to a Wi-Fi network, your device is essentially communicating with a nearby router, which acts as a gateway to the internet.

The Difference Between Wi-Fi and Internet

It’s crucial to note that Wi-Fi and internet are not the same thing. Wi-Fi is a means of connecting to the internet, but it’s not the internet itself. Think of Wi-Fi as a road that leads to a city, while the internet is the city itself. Just because you’re on the road (connected to Wi-Fi) doesn’t mean you’ve arrived at your destination (have access to the internet). This distinction is key to understanding why you can have Wi-Fi but no internet.

Reasons Why You Might Have Wi-Fi but No Internet

There are several reasons why you might find yourself in the situation of having Wi-Fi but no internet. Some of the most common causes include:

Your internet service provider (ISP) is experiencing outages or technical difficulties. This can be due to a variety of factors, such as maintenance, upgrades, or unexpected issues with their infrastructure.
The router or modem is malfunctioning or not configured correctly. This can be a result of improper setup, outdated firmware, or physical damage to the device.
Your device is not configured to obtain an IP address automatically. This can be a problem if your device is set to use a static IP address, which may not be compatible with the network you’re trying to connect to.
The network you’re connected to is not providing internet access. This can be the case if you’re connected to a Wi-Fi network that’s not intended for internet access, such as a network used for local file sharing or device communication.
You’ve exceeded your data limit or your ISP has throttled your connection. If you’ve used up all your allocated data or your ISP has intentionally slowed down your connection, you may find yourself with Wi-Fi but no internet.

Troubleshooting Steps to Resolve the Issue

If you’re experiencing the frustrating situation of having Wi-Fi but no internet, there are several troubleshooting steps you can take to resolve the issue.

Basic Troubleshooting

First, try restarting your router and modem. This simple step can often resolve connectivity issues by resetting the devices and re-establishing the connection. Next, check your physical connections to ensure that all cables are securely plugged in and not damaged. You should also verify that your Wi-Fi network is properly configured and that you’re connected to the correct network.

Advanced Troubleshooting

If basic troubleshooting steps don’t resolve the issue, you may need to dive deeper into the problem. Check your device’s IP address configuration to ensure that it’s set to obtain an IP address automatically. You can also try releasing and renewing your IP address to get a new one from the network. Additionally, check your router’s settings to ensure that it’s configured correctly and that the firmware is up to date.

Using Diagnostic Tools

There are several diagnostic tools available that can help you identify and resolve the issue. You can use tools like ping or traceroute to test your connection and identify any bottlenecks or issues. You can also use online speed test tools to check your internet speed and determine if the issue is with your ISP or your local network.

What is the difference between Wi-Fi and internet?

The terms Wi-Fi and internet are often used interchangeably, but they are not the same thing. Wi-Fi refers to a type of wireless networking technology that allows devices to connect to a network without the use of cables or wires. It is a local area network (LAN) technology that enables devices to communicate with each other and with a wireless router, which is typically connected to a physical network or the internet. On the other hand, the internet is a global network of interconnected computers and servers that store and provide access to vast amounts of information.

In other words, Wi-Fi is a means of accessing the internet, but it is not the internet itself. You can have Wi-Fi connectivity without having access to the internet, and vice versa. For example, you can set up a Wi-Fi network in your home or office without connecting it to the internet, and devices can still communicate with each other over the network. However, if you want to access online resources, such as websites, email, or social media, you need to have a connection to the internet, which is typically provided by an internet service provider (ISP).

Can I still use my devices without internet access?

Yes, you can still use your devices without internet access, although the functionality may be limited. For example, you can use your smartphone or tablet to play games, listen to music, or watch videos that are stored locally on the device. You can also use your device to access files, documents, and other data that are stored locally. Additionally, many apps, such as productivity software or note-taking apps, can be used offline, allowing you to create and edit content without an internet connection.

However, some features and apps may not work without internet access. For example, you will not be able to access online resources, such as websites, email, or social media, or use apps that require a connection to a server or cloud service. You also will not be able to receive updates or sync data with cloud services, such as iCloud or Google Drive. Nevertheless, having Wi-Fi connectivity without internet access can still be useful in certain situations, such as when you need to transfer files between devices or use a local network to communicate with other devices.

What are the common causes of Wi-Fi disconnections?

Wi-Fi disconnections can be caused by a variety of factors, including physical obstructions, interference from nearby networks, and hardware or software issues. Physical obstructions, such as walls or furniture, can block or weaken the Wi-Fi signal, causing disconnections. Interference from nearby networks can also cause disconnections, especially if the networks are using the same or overlapping channels. Additionally, hardware issues, such as a faulty router or Wi-Fi adapter, can cause disconnections, as can software issues, such as outdated firmware or driver problems.

To minimize Wi-Fi disconnections, you can try moving your router to a central location, using a range extender to improve coverage, and changing the channel or frequency band used by your router to minimize interference. You can also try updating your router’s firmware and ensuring that your devices are running the latest operating system and software updates. Additionally, using a Wi-Fi analyzer to scan for nearby networks and identify potential sources of interference can help you to optimize your network configuration and reduce disconnections.
